What can be done to protect people from high energy prices? Sepi Golzari-Munro of The Energy and Climate Intelligence Unit and Kevin Keane, BBC Scotland's Environment, Energy & Rural Affairs Correspondent, join Phil and Rajdeep to discuss the current volatile oil and gas markets, and what it means for people in Scotland. Is the solution further North Sea extraction, or could green energy move quickly enough to fill the market demand and save customers some cash?
